  12. Yup, the power delivery is early and then drops off courtesy of the small turbo, and to an extent, the factory intercooler. The small turbo generates too much heat too early, in turn the intercooler isn't up to the job, thus increasing the intake air temps (IAT). The ECU sees this and reduce boots, power drops. The outside ambient air temp was 20 deg Celsius when we did the runs. The IATs were getting hotter after each run. Not surprised. I wasn't expecting it to hold steady all through the rev band. A bigger turbo will help to prolong that power delivery. Likewise a larger intercooler will also aid in sustaining the power band longer. My next move is to get a larger intercooler, but I'll b looking at doing that towards the end of our winter.

  14. i recently put my Superb 220 on a dyno run, as i curious to see how much power it was making with an APR Stg 1 ECU tune and APR DSG tune. 3x runs, each time doing approx. 222 kW (299 hp) & 532 Nm (393 ft lbs), at the wheel. one of the runs...... Pretty happy with those numbers, given its mostly software. power is bang on as expected, based on APR's claims. torque is more than i expected. i was expecting between 490 to 500 Nm. as u said, for a FWD - 0-60 times r nonsense!! prior to getting the DSG tune done on mine, the 80-120 km/h time dropped from 5.8 to 3.4 secs, with the Stage 1 tune.

  16. For the pre-facelift Superb, sadly there is no LED option. Only the facelift version comes with proper LED headlights. U could replace ur xenon bulbs with LED bulbs, but I would not recommend it as they require massive heat sinks or fans and get very hot. U won't b able to put the headlight cover at the back on, meaning it's no longer sealed, allowing dirt & water to get inside the unit. I got my Phillips XtremeVisions from Powerbulbs.   19. the DTR6054 is drop in turbo that is easy to transition from an IS20. works with the existing factory components, including factory intercooler if desired and reuses factory wastegate and diverter valve. although, to make the most of the turbo, an upgraded intercooler, intake and TCU tune is recommended. i just need to upgrade my intercooler as i've already done the others. comes with the stage 3 software, which also has the optional FWD file that will limit wheel spin by limiting how torque hits. i had a conversation with the APR tuner here, and they say that it is perfect for my setup.

  24. For those who want to know how to do the coding after changing the battery, using OBDEleven or VCDS, follow the instructions in the link below. It's very important to set the Rated Battery Capacity and the Battery Technology type. For AGM batteries, make sure u select "Fleece". https://forum.obdeleven.com/thread/4252/coding-new-battery I've got an EFB+ battery, so mine is set accordingly.
